The global Titanium Exhaust Heat Shield Panel Market is witnessing a surge in demand driven by the automotive and aerospace industries’ increasing focus on vehicle efficiency, weight reduction, and thermal management. Titanium panels are valued for their high heat resistance, corrosion durability, and lightweight properties, making them essential in advanced exhaust systems.

Rising regulatory pressures to reduce vehicular emissions and improve fuel efficiency are contributing to the adoption of titanium heat shields. Moreover, the growth of electric and hybrid vehicles, which require optimized thermal management systems, is further propelling the market’s expansion. Analysts anticipate steady global growth during the forecast period.

The Asia-Pacific region is emerging as a dominant player, attributed to rapid industrialization, expanding automotive production, and the presence of cost-competitive titanium manufacturers. North America and Europe continue to witness significant market traction due to stringent emission regulations and the adoption of lightweight materials in luxury vehicles.

Market Restraints and Challenges

Despite its advantages, the Titanium Exhaust Heat Shield Panel Market faces certain constraints. High raw material costs and complex manufacturing processes limit accessibility for price-sensitive segments. The availability of alternative materials, such as aluminum and composite heat shields, also poses competitive challenges. Moreover, fluctuating titanium supply due to geopolitical factors can influence market stability.

Global Market Size and Forecast

The global Titanium Exhaust Heat Shield Panel Market was valued at approximately USD 420 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 710 million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.5% during the forecast period. The growth is primarily attributed to the rising adoption of lightweight, high-performance materials in exhaust systems and thermal management solutions.

Regionally, Asia-Pacific accounted for over 40% of the market share in 2024, followed by North America and Europe. The demand in emerging economies is expected to outpace mature markets due to increasing vehicle production, expansion of public transport fleets, and the adoption of stricter emission norms.
